diff --git a/.drone.yml b/.drone.yml
index 7f43290e..fba57192 100644
--- a/.drone.yml
+++ b/.drone.yml
@@ -8,7 +8,7 @@ platform:
 
 steps:
 - name: vet
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- go vet ./...
   environment:
@@ -18,7 +18,7 @@ steps:
     path: /go
 
 - name: test
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- go test -cover ./...
   environment:
@@ -161,7 +161,7 @@ platform:
 
 steps:
 - name: build-push
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- "go build -v -ldflags \"-X main.version=${DRONE_COMMIT_SHA:0:8}\" -a -tags netgo -o release/linux/amd64/drone-docker ./cmd/drone-docker"
   environment:
@@ -173,7 +173,7 @@ steps:
       - tag
 
 - name: build-tag
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- "go build -v -ldflags \"-X main.version=${DRONE_TAG##v}\" -a -tags netgo -o release/linux/amd64/drone-docker ./cmd/drone-docker"
   environment:
@@ -184,7 +184,7 @@ steps:
     - tag
 
 - name: executable
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- ./release/linux/amd64/drone-docker --help
 
@@ -224,7 +224,7 @@ platform:
 
 steps:
 - name: build-push
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- "go build -v -ldflags \"-X main.version=${DRONE_COMMIT_SHA:0:8}\" -a -tags netgo -o release/linux/arm64/drone-docker ./cmd/drone-docker"
   environment:
@@ -236,7 +236,7 @@ steps:
       - tag
 
 - name: build-tag
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- "go build -v -ldflags \"-X main.version=${DRONE_TAG##v}\" -a -tags netgo -o release/linux/arm64/drone-docker ./cmd/drone-docker"
   environment:
@@ -247,7 +247,7 @@ steps:
     - tag
 
 - name: executable
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- ./release/linux/arm64/drone-docker --help
 
@@ -287,7 +287,7 @@ platform:
 
 steps:
 - name: build-push
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- "go build -v -ldflags \"-X main.version=${DRONE_COMMIT_SHA:0:8}\" -a -tags netgo -o release/linux/arm/drone-docker ./cmd/drone-docker"
   environment:
@@ -299,7 +299,7 @@ steps:
       - tag
 
 - name: build-tag
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- "go build -v -ldflags \"-X main.version=${DRONE_TAG##v}\" -a -tags netgo -o release/linux/arm/drone-docker ./cmd/drone-docker"
   environment:
@@ -310,7 +310,7 @@ steps:
     - tag
 
 - name: executable
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- ./release/linux/arm/drone-docker --help
 
@@ -383,7 +383,7 @@ platform:
 
 steps:
 - name: build-push
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- "go build -v -ldflags \"-X main.version=${DRONE_COMMIT_SHA:0:8}\" -a -tags netgo -o release/linux/amd64/drone-gcr ./cmd/drone-gcr"
   environment:
@@ -395,7 +395,7 @@ steps:
       - tag
 
 - name: build-tag
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- "go build -v -ldflags \"-X main.version=${DRONE_TAG##v}\" -a -tags netgo -o release/linux/amd64/drone-gcr ./cmd/drone-gcr"
   environment:
@@ -441,7 +441,7 @@ platform:
 
 steps:
 - name: build-push
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- "go build -v -ldflags \"-X main.version=${DRONE_COMMIT_SHA:0:8}\" -a -tags netgo -o release/linux/arm64/drone-gcr ./cmd/drone-gcr"
   environment:
@@ -453,7 +453,7 @@ steps:
       - tag
 
 - name: build-tag
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- "go build -v -ldflags \"-X main.version=${DRONE_TAG##v}\" -a -tags netgo -o release/linux/arm64/drone-gcr ./cmd/drone-gcr"
   environment:
@@ -499,7 +499,7 @@ platform:
 
 steps:
 - name: build-push
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- "go build -v -ldflags \"-X main.version=${DRONE_COMMIT_SHA:0:8}\" -a -tags netgo -o release/linux/arm/drone-gcr ./cmd/drone-gcr"
   environment:
@@ -511,7 +511,7 @@ steps:
       - tag
 
 - name: build-tag
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- "go build -v -ldflags \"-X main.version=${DRONE_TAG##v}\" -a -tags netgo -o release/linux/arm/drone-gcr ./cmd/drone-gcr"
   environment:
@@ -587,7 +587,7 @@ platform:
 
 steps:
 - name: build-push
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- "go build -v -ldflags \"-X main.version=${DRONE_COMMIT_SHA:0:8}\" -a -tags netgo -o release/linux/amd64/drone-ecr ./cmd/drone-ecr"
   environment:
@@ -599,7 +599,7 @@ steps:
       - tag
 
 - name: build-tag
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- "go build -v -ldflags \"-X main.version=${DRONE_TAG##v}\" -a -tags netgo -o release/linux/amd64/drone-ecr ./cmd/drone-ecr"
   environment:
@@ -645,7 +645,7 @@ platform:
 
 steps:
 - name: build-push
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- "go build -v -ldflags \"-X main.version=${DRONE_COMMIT_SHA:0:8}\" -a -tags netgo -o release/linux/arm64/drone-ecr ./cmd/drone-ecr"
   environment:
@@ -657,7 +657,7 @@ steps:
       - tag
 
 - name: build-tag
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- "go build -v -ldflags \"-X main.version=${DRONE_TAG##v}\" -a -tags netgo -o release/linux/arm64/drone-ecr ./cmd/drone-ecr"
   environment:
@@ -703,7 +703,7 @@ platform:
 
 steps:
 - name: build-push
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- "go build -v -ldflags \"-X main.version=${DRONE_COMMIT_SHA:0:8}\" -a -tags netgo -o release/linux/arm/drone-ecr ./cmd/drone-ecr"
   environment:
@@ -715,7 +715,7 @@ steps:
       - tag
 
 - name: build-tag
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- "go build -v -ldflags \"-X main.version=${DRONE_TAG##v}\" -a -tags netgo -o release/linux/arm/drone-ecr ./cmd/drone-ecr"
   environment:
@@ -791,7 +791,7 @@ platform:
 
 steps:
 - name: build-push
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- "go build -v -ldflags \"-X main.version=${DRONE_COMMIT_SHA:0:8}\" -a -tags netgo -o release/linux/amd64/drone-heroku ./cmd/drone-heroku"
   environment:
@@ -803,7 +803,7 @@ steps:
       - tag
 
 - name: build-tag
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- "go build -v -ldflags \"-X main.version=${DRONE_TAG##v}\" -a -tags netgo -o release/linux/amd64/drone-heroku ./cmd/drone-heroku"
   environment:
@@ -849,7 +849,7 @@ platform:
 
 steps:
 - name: build-push
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- "go build -v -ldflags \"-X main.version=${DRONE_COMMIT_SHA:0:8}\" -a -tags netgo -o release/linux/arm64/drone-heroku ./cmd/drone-heroku"
   environment:
@@ -861,7 +861,7 @@ steps:
       - tag
 
 - name: build-tag
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- "go build -v -ldflags \"-X main.version=${DRONE_TAG##v}\" -a -tags netgo -o release/linux/arm64/drone-heroku ./cmd/drone-heroku"
   environment:
@@ -907,7 +907,7 @@ platform:
 
 steps:
 - name: build-push
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- "go build -v -ldflags \"-X main.version=${DRONE_COMMIT_SHA:0:8}\" -a -tags netgo -o release/linux/arm/drone-heroku ./cmd/drone-heroku"
   environment:
@@ -919,7 +919,7 @@ steps:
       - tag
 
 - name: build-tag
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- "go build -v -ldflags \"-X main.version=${DRONE_TAG##v}\" -a -tags netgo -o release/linux/arm/drone-heroku ./cmd/drone-heroku"
   environment:
@@ -995,7 +995,7 @@ platform:
 
 steps:
 - name: build-push
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- "go build -v -ldflags \"-X main.build=${DRONE_BUILD_NUMBER}\" -a -tags netgo -o release/linux/amd64/drone-acr ./cmd/drone-acr"
   environment:
@@ -1007,7 +1007,7 @@ steps:
       - tag
 
 - name: build-tag
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- "go build -v -ldflags \"-X main.version=${DRONE_TAG##v} -X main.build=${DRONE_BUILD_NUMBER}\" -a -tags netgo -o release/linux/amd64/drone-acr ./cmd/drone-acr"
   environment:
@@ -1053,7 +1053,7 @@ platform:
 
 steps:
 - name: build-push
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- "go build -v -ldflags \"-X main.build=${DRONE_BUILD_NUMBER}\" -a -tags netgo -o release/linux/arm64/drone-acr ./cmd/drone-acr"
   environment:
@@ -1065,7 +1065,7 @@ steps:
       - tag
 
 - name: build-tag
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- "go build -v -ldflags \"-X main.version=${DRONE_TAG##v} -X main.build=${DRONE_BUILD_NUMBER}\" -a -tags netgo -o release/linux/arm64/drone-acr ./cmd/drone-acr"
   environment:
@@ -1111,7 +1111,7 @@ platform:
 
 steps:
 - name: build-push
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- "go build -v -ldflags \"-X main.build=${DRONE_BUILD_NUMBER}\" -a -tags netgo -o release/linux/arm/drone-acr ./cmd/drone-acr"
   environment:
@@ -1123,7 +1123,7 @@ steps:
       - tag
 
 - name: build-tag
-  image: golang:1.11
+  image: golang:1.13
   commands:
   - "go build -v -ldflags \"-X main.version=${DRONE_TAG##v} -X main.build=${DRONE_BUILD_NUMBER}\" -a -tags netgo -o release/linux/arm/drone-acr ./cmd/drone-acr"
   environment:
diff --git a/pipeline.libsonnet b/pipeline.libsonnet
index 4d44a410..08f102fa 100644
--- a/pipeline.libsonnet
+++ b/pipeline.libsonnet
@@ -5,7 +5,7 @@ local test_pipeline_name = 'testing';
 local windows(os) = os == 'windows';
 
 local golang_image(os, version) =
-  'golang:' + '1.11' + if windows(os) then '-windowsservercore-' + version else '';
+  'golang:' + '1.13' + if windows(os) then '-windowsservercore-' + version else '';
 
 {
   test(os='linux', arch='amd64', version='')::